Thanks to a newly formed community effort, there should be a BitRitter flatpak soonโ„ข.

#BitRitter #FlatPak #PasswordManagers #BitWarden #VaultWarden

Do i know any SQLX magicians?

We have an issue over at https://codeberg.org/Chfkch/bitritter/issues/59 and not sure why SQLX cannot create the database on the fly on some machines. I am pretty sure it worked at some point in time, but since i cannot reproduce it on my computer (several people can), i am out of ideas.

   

#SQLX #BitRitter #RustLang

Trouble building

Hi! I'm looking to try out Bitritter, but unfortunately v0.1.1 from the Alpine repos is unable to log into my Vaultwarden server. I tried building latest from source and, after installing all dependencies on my phone, ran into the following errors: ``` mat@hermes ~/D/bitritter (main)> cargo bui...

Codeberg.org

After some spontaneous hacking on BitRitters edit mode, i made some good progress: First time i could change values and save them to the database/server.
It really means alot to le because after 2 failed applications for funding i ditched the topic for too long.
It might need a major rework of the UI internals though, but now i am motivated again.

#BitRitter #VaultWarden #BitWarden #PasswordManager #LinuxPhone #LinuxMobile #Relm4

People who build BitRitter from main:
I have moved the vault settings location to respect the XDG directories.
New location should be `$XDG_CONFIG_DIR/bitritter`, so for most linux users it should be `$HOME/.config/bitritter`.

Either you move your .db3 file by hand or setup the vault anew.

Already synced vaultvitems are not affected, since rbw handles those under the hood.

If you have problems, there is a closes issue you can reopen.

#BitRitter #BitWarden #RBW #VaultWarden

Finally rebased some branches for #BitRitter (thanks jujutsu) to get translations and XDG spec working.
When i have inserted all strings, i will tag another release.

Would have given me headaches with plain git.

Nextvon the list is (still) flatpak bundling, then 2 minor issues.

#JujutsuVCS #BitWarden

Since i got back into BitRitter development, i had some success in getting Fluent translations up and running. This is something that will stay, sorry gettext etc.
But a bigger achievement was something i did not understand when designing the architecture: RBW provides a daemon that can do the heavy lifting for me and not decryption etc. needed on my end. I misread some stuff about this since i was just a rookie. Big rewrite incoming.
#BitRitter #RBW #Relm4 #RustLang #BitWarden #VaultWarden

Ok, so i didn't have much time the past year to work on BitRitter, but recently at least i got the initial code working for translations.
I will try to set it up in the next weeks, so we can use the Weblate instance from @Codeberg .

Another thing i was working on in the rare free time was editing entries and saving them to the vault. I got bitten by framework specific stuff, so that will not be solved soon.

#BitRitter #RustLang #LinuxMobile #MobileLinux #Weblate #CodeBerg

Now that my sick days are nearing an end, my grant application for my #FOSS project got rejected. ๐Ÿฅบ
I hope i will find enough time between day job and family to develop soon.

Also, i will try to apply to some more funds over the next year.
Thinking about @sovtechfund for instance? What else is there you can recommend?
#BitRitter

Seems i need to get more funding for #BitRitter in recent developments about the #BitWarden client licensing.

Though i hope to have plans to have a first "real" release this year.

Never knew it became that urgent and neccessary.

#VaultWarden #FOSS

Can somebody invite me - or rather the account for my #foss app (#BitRitter) - to fosstodon.org?

@codemonkeymike maybe?